
This week, WK Social held discussion circles at the Ana Rosa Institute to address a crucial topic: women’s rights, with a focus on sexual and reproductive rights.
The goal of the talks was to open an ongoing dialogue with young people aged 14 to 18, covering themes such as gender equality and combating discrimination against women and girls. During the meetings, we encouraged reflections on the limitations imposed by gender and the importance of ensuring fundamental rights and dignity for all women.
This initiative reinforces our commitment to the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), especially SDG 5, which aims to achieve gender equality and empower all women and girls. We continue to believe that education and dialogue are essential paths to social transformation.
